Mohneesh Rai
Assistant Professor of Law
Mohneesh Rai is an Assistant Professor of Law at Manipal Law School, Manipal Academy of Higher Education, Bengaluru. His interests sit at the intersection of critical legal studies, caste and gender studies, criminal justice and transformative constitutionalism, with particular focus on how structural violence is produced and reproduced through banal legal processes. He holds an LL.M. in Law and Development from Azim Premji University, Bengaluru (2024), and a B.A. LL.B. (Hons.) from NALSAR University of Law Hyderabad (2020). He is an advocate enrolled with the Bar Council of Rajasthan and has qualified the UGC-NET in Law, as well as the All India Bar Examination (AIBE). He was a National Talent Search Examination (NTSE) Scholar in 2012. Before entering academia, he was an Associate Legal Manager at ITC Limited, Kolkata, where he drafted and negotiated commercial agreements, advised on litigation strategy and compliance, and worked on IP strategy and litigation. He has previously been associated with Vidhi Centre for Legal Policy, the Indian Society of International Law (ISIL), the People’s Union for Civil Liberties (PUCL), the Rajasthan High Court and the Supreme Court of India. He has also appeared for the Rajasthan Judicial Services (Mains) Examination. His writing has appeared in the Oxford Human Rights Hub Blog, The Wire, The Columbia University’s RightsViews Blog, covering civil society regulation under FCRA, housing and the right to life for Delhi’s slum dwellers, and electoral accessibility for the disabled population in Rajasthan.
